RESPONSIBILITIES:

The successful applicant will be responsible for taking an active role in facilitating the education of interns and is responsible for supervising, training, instructing and mentoring interns in all aspects of clinical management, with emphasis on patient care and professional development.

The Clinician is responsible for preparing interns in conducting patient evaluations and is accountable for overseeing and verifying quality patient care, monitoring patient progress, and specific performance indicators. The Clinician will be required to effectively evaluate student/interns on their clinical competencies, formal clinic exams, educational requirements, counsel students when needed, and ensure compliance to clinical policies and procedures. The Resource Clinician will have an active role in the remediation of students. Evidence of practicing ethical practice building strategies is required. Resource Clinicians will also be involved in quality assurance tasks such as file audits.

Clinicians are role models for our interns, so it is essential that the successful candidate conduct themselves in a positive and professional manner in all that they do. Scholarship and institutional service, including practice development, are expectations of this position.
